Environments: Audit-Log Viewer (Cindervale)

The Cindervale audit-log viewer runs in three environments: sandbox, staging, prod. Prod is read-only against the sealed log store; staging points at a synthetic feed refreshed nightly. On-call should never grant write paths in prod — escalate instead. Session timeouts are shorter in prod by design, so expect re-auth complaints. If the viewer misbehaves, check environment parity first. Each environment's active configuration is listed below.

settings of kagap-fajep:
[zorys]
team = ulavan
access_code = ac_08fa8f
host = zorys.kelvinet.corp
port = 3000
owner = wenix.weneth
peer = wenath.brasksys.test

Action item from the Corvane tile-cache outage: the eviction thresholds that let stale tiles linger were set ad hoc and never reviewed. Owner will land a config change this sprint moving them into version control, with alerts when hit rates drop below target. For the sync, the proposed replacement constants are recorded below for review.

limits module of tafop-hahop:
WEIGHTS = {
    "julmir": 223,
    "belox": 987,
    "lamion": 470,
    "pelath": 609,
    "fraok": 1010,
    "eliion": 343,
    "drudor": 342,
}

Alert: reconnect-storm on the Larkspur realtime service. This fires when websocket clients drop and immediately re-dial in a tight loop, usually triggered by a known bug in the Thistledown client library where the backoff timer resets on a half-closed connection. For new team members: the symptom is a sawtooth pattern on the active-connections graph and elevated CPU on the Marrowgate edge nodes. It is rarely a server-side fault. Mitigation is to enable the server-enforced backoff flag. Full diagnosis steps are documented on the internal page.

wiki page, fahaf-yagag: https://confluence.qorvellabs.internal/pages/display/pages/display